Why the Xbox One lost this generation’s console battle
Coming off of the relative disaster that was the PlayStation 3 and the huge success of…
Coming off of the relative disaster that was the PlayStation 3 and the huge success of…
I held off commenting here about E3 2017 long enough to really form up in my…